Husqvarna 6021P Review

Husqvarna 6021P Review

Whilst people are generally being steered towards more environmentally friendly options, gas mowers still remain a good option for larger sized lawns. I recently reviewed the Husqvarna 6021P, which looked very promising in all of the promotional material I looked at beforehand. During this review I'm going to tell you how I got on with it, what I liked and if there was anything that I wasn't so keen on.

Husqvarna 6021P Review - Specifications

ManufacturerHusqvarna
Model Name6021P
EngineKohler Courage Single
Cutting Width21 inches
Cutting Modes3 in 1 - Mulching, Rear Bag Collection, Side Discharge
Cutting Heights1.25 - 3.42 inches
Self PropelNo
Weight72 lbs

Husqvarna 6021P Review – Key Features

  • Setting It Up – This was as simple as I hoped it would be. After I took it out of the box I tightened up the handle bar, put the grass bag on and then filled it with oil, which was included (bonus points for that!). After that it was just a case of adding the fuel and I was raring to go.
  • Size and Build – In terms of size, the Husqvarna 6021P is a fairly standard 21 inches. The handle even folds over nicely to reduce its storage size. I wasn’t too impressed with the construction however. Whilst you do get a metal deck, the metal is a lot thinner than on other gas mowers I’ve used. When you consider that this is susceptible to rust and it’s not really that thick, I’m not sure how durable it’s going to be. Apart from that the mower is made out of plastic components, which are mainly okay apart from the wheels. In my opinion the wheels don’t seem like they will handle that much punishment and I think with regular use on uneven ground they could suffer. They also seem to be positioned too wide, meaning you need to overlap on every pass to cut all your grass. One other thing I found is that the flap at the back of the mower seems to be too rigid. When I was mowing with one of the lower cut settings I found it dragged along the floor which made pushing the mower more difficult. The one thing I did like was the fuel tank on this model. Sometimes the fuel tanks on gas mowers are so small that you end up spilling gas everywhere but on this one it’s got a wide mouth, making it easy to fill with gas.
  • Kohler Engine – The engine seems really solid and reliable and has an automatic choke. You don’t have to worry about priming it, you just pull and go. When I was mowing the engine seemed to have a decent amount of power and that’s always a good sign with a gas mower.
  • 3-in-1 Cutting System – You can choose a cutting mode to suit the conditions of your garden. You can bag your clippings to keep everything nice and tidy, we can mulch to feed back nutrients to your grass and you can side discharge when taking down those weeds. Having options is never a bad thing.
  • Handle –With the handle, there were good points and there were bad points. I liked the fact that you can adjust the height of the handle as I’ve sometimes used mowers that have a low handle that can’t be adjusted and I end up with backache when I’ve finished. However the foam on the handle really isn’t up to par. Its poor quality and I really feel that it would tear easily. To try and prevent or repair this you could try using duct tape (my friend recommended this to me).

Husqvarna 6021P Review – How Did It Perform?

  • Cutting Ability – In terms of cutting, the mower performed pretty well for me. I found the engine packed plenty of power and allowed me to cruise through practically all areas of my grass. Only on some real overgrown stuff did it bog down a bit – but I expected that. I made use of the mulch feature and the results were more than acceptable. I also found that the mower ran very efficiently on gas, meaning it’s quite cheap to run – bonus!
  • Grass Collection – My experience when switching to the rear bagging option wasn’t so good. There seemed to be a design fault as there was a gap between the base of the bag and where it attaches to the mower. This resulted in clippings being blown out of this back onto my lawn. It is possible to plug this gap with tape (another recommendation from my friend) but you shouldn’t really have to do this in the first place.
  • Manoeuvrability – The mower rolled along my lawn fairly effortlessly (on higher cut settings) but I just got the sense that the wheels are fairly fragile. I think this is something that Husqvarna need to address as I also had similar doubts when reviewing the 7021P model. I did have a few problems on the lowest cut setting though as the flap at the rear of the mower did seem to catch on the ground. Again you can adjust this – but why should you have to?
  • Usability – It’s super easy to start which is a relief as when people think of gas mowers they usually think of machines that destroy your shoulders. However even with a light pull on the cord this one fired up no problem. From there it’s fairly straightforward to operate it. Keep hold of the dead man’s bar and push in the direction you want to go.

Husqvarna 6021P Review – Who Should Buy This Mower?

There’s no doubt that this model is priced reasonably for what you get. As long as you don’t expect it to last for years and years like in the old days, I think you’ll be fairly pleased with it. Its size is ideally suited to medium-size garden and I would recommend that you use it on flat ground.

Husqvarna 6021P Review – Who Shouldn’t Buy This Mower?

Anyone that tends to use and abuse their lawn mowers should walk right past this one. The quality of construction is not as high as I would like to see and I don’t think it would last long if not treated with a certain degree of care. I also wouldn’t be too keen on regularly using this on a garden that had a lot of bumps and dips because the part where the wheels connects to the mower seem to be a bit weak in my opinion. In terms of size, I wouldn’t use it on a large lawn because of the wheel placement. You end up having to overlap your passes because the wheels are placed too wide and this means the job takes longer. The Husqvarna 6021P won’t be a perfect fit for everyone but is an economical solution to maintaining your garden. The cut is exceptionally good, it mulches really well, is easy to start up and easy-to-use in general. As long as you are aware of both its positives and limitations before you buy it I’m sure you will be happy.
